Police nabs two kidnappers in Anambra

Police operatives in Anambra State have arrested two suspected kidnappers and members of an armed robbery gang, operating at Uga, Ekwulobia, Umuchu, Nkpologu, Ezinifite, Aguata communities and environs.

Disclosing this in a statement on Thursday, spokesperson for the Anambra State Police Command, Tochukwu Ikenga said the suspects were nabbed by security operatives comprising of military, civil defence and other security forces carried out the arrest.

He said the suspects were members of a notorious secessionist group involved in kidnapping, car snatching and armed robbery operating at the remote communities in the state.

Ikenga noted that the suspects were arrested on Thursday through a follow-up of an investigation of a kidnap incident in the Aguata community reported to the police in 2023.

“In a follow-up of an investigation of a kidnap incident in Aguata reported to the police sometime last year, joint security operatives working on credible information, in mid-day of today 22/8/2024 comprising of military, civil defence and other security forces arrested two notorious secessionist group members involved in kidnapping, car snatching, and armed robbery operating at uga, Ekwulobia, Umuchu, Nkpologu, Ezinifite, Aguata environs.

“Among the two suspects (names withheld), one has bullet wounds on his leg, while the other, a fake pastor preparing criminal charms for the gang members has confessed to the crime and is already assisting the Police in apprehending other gang members.

“The suspects have also provided information on the location of the shrine where they prepare the charms and some snatched vehicles,” the statement read.

He stated that the Commissioner of Police, Nnaghe Itam has assured people of the state that the command is working tirelessly on all reported cases, especially incidents of kidnap, armed robbery and otherwise, as the trust bestowed on us for the protection of life and properties are not taken for granted.
